Transaction 58cc7ee624005344df6de20cb24b0460779d39dec112ac065fd0de20275f5332
1 Input
1 Output
-
58cc7ee624005344df6de20cb24b0460779d39dec112ac065fd0de20275f5332:0
- value
- 19192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505163682f6e2afb6707b06f92bb1d30754ad21e OP_EQUAL
- address
- 391hUrCHdmJGQ6HdeYzJTy48ACyTet5rkt